Organizing Research and Book Writing
The key insight is to stay organized when conducting research for a book by keeping all papers as PDFs in a named and dated folder, making notes on each paper for searchability. When reading books, underline important passages and mark citations for further review. After finishing the book, transfer the underlined passages and citation links to a Word document for refining. Utilize a tool like the archive to structure the book by creating text files containing grouped research notes on specific topics.
